JOB DESCRIPTION.
To work with the Centre team to deliver counselling to individuals and couples from the Urdu-speaking community.
To remain an effective counsellor the individual will engage in ongoing professional development training and development, ongoing individual supervision and participate in group supervision as required.
Participate, if required, in talks to community groups and other health professional groups.
This role requires you to enrol in one of the below courses to become a fully qualified Relationship Counsellor with Relate West Surrey.
The courses that are available are as follows and details of these course can be found on the Relate website: www.relate.org.uk/train-us
Diploma in Relationship Counselling | Relate
A Diploma is a 2 year Level 4 and Level 5 course for which a Level 3 qualification is required.
Post-Qualifying Certificate in Relational Counselling | Relate
The Post-Qualifying course is a 1 year Level 5 course where a candidate would already have a Level 4 qualification.
Which course you undertook would depend entirely on your current qualifications.
Whilst you are a trainee counsellor, you must sign a placement agreement to complete the required number of face to face counselling hours as part of your course.

To adhere to all relevant guidelines and procedures established by the Centre, or adopted by it in pursuance of Relate National policies.
To work at times and places reasonably decided by the Centre Management and not at unauthorised times or places. The minimum requirement to offer is to be available for 50 hours of client work over the period of the placement.
To limit counselling work to those methods and techniques which are approved by Relate.
To make full use of Relate’s provision of individual and group supervision and support. The current annual requirement is 18 hours of individual supervision and attendance at a minimum of 8 supervisor led groups a year.
To supply any records and information reasonably requested by Supervisors and Trainers, this may require recorded tapes of client sessions and this will be arranged following recognised procedures.
To keep the required confidential Relate records of counselling work. To supply them in good time on completion of clients’ counselling, to the Administration and to provide any other records and information when requested by the CEO or Supervisor.
